It was recently in the news that Richa Chadha is going to be a part of special internationally acclaimed production in Mumbai at the Prithvi Theater this coming week. With this, Richa becomes the first Indian actress to have the privilege of being a part of one of most talked about plays from around the world.

Written by Iranian playwright Nassim Soleimanpour, White Rabbit Red Rabbit is the most difficult play for any actor. With no director, no sets the play is a solo show by an actor who gets the script literally on the stage when the audience is settled in. Known to always take upon challenging roles, Richa is making this one of one-time only stage return. It's an honour for any actor to be essaying this part as very few actors around the world have been privileged to have bagged an opportunity to volunteer for the said play. The performance is set to take place on 16th of August.

When asked Richa She said, "I was excited when Ali Fazal referred my name to Quasar for this play. It's an exciting play to be a part of. I am delighted that I could take this challenge on! I worked with QTP in the past during Thespo and to come back and collaborate is so enjoyable for us both".
